“Simply the best,” “Jeopardy!” tweeted. “Thank you, Alex.”

Trebek passed away in early November after battling pancreatic cancer.

Even Pat Sajak, host of “Wheel Of Fortune,” admitted that “no one was better.” (RELATED: ‘No One Was Better’: Pat Sajak Opens Up About His Friend Alex Trebek)

“No one admires what he accomplished more than I do,” Sajak told People magazine.

Trebek ended his final week of “Jeopardy!” episodes with a great message of hope.

“I’d like you to open up your hands and open up your heart to those who are still suffering because of COVID-19, people who are suffering through no fault of their own,” Trebek said in a monologue, as previously reported.

“We’re trying to build a gentler, kinder society,” Trebek added. “And if we all pitch in just a little bit, we’re gonna get there.”
